> I have integrate standalone tiles in my project (for my company).
> When JRun 4 stop (or I trigger the hot-deploy to reload the webapp), it will throw a NullPointerException.
> After some study, the NPE should be cause by the absence of super.init(config) call in TilesServlet.java
> I'll attach my one-line patch. Hope useful...
